R-CALF USA CEO Bill Bullard will speak at two meetings in Arkansas, on Feb. 23 and 24. R-CALF USA Region XII Director Mike Jones will be present and available to answer questions at both events. Jones is from Dardanelle and represents Arkansas, Louisiana, and Mississippi.
On Friday, Feb. 23, R-CALF USA will host a producer meeting and barbeque dinner. The meeting will begin at 6 p.m. at the Yell County Wildlife Federation Building located at 10035 Wildlife Lane in Dardanelle. Local processor Taylor’s Fatted Calf and Greenway Equipment will sponsor the meal and event. Friday’s event is free and open to the public. RSVPs are encouraged, call Mike Jones at (479) 699-4030 or email 13cattlecompany@gmail.com.
On Saturday, Feb. 24, the Arkansas Angus Association will host its annual meeting at the MarketPlace Grill located at 600 Skyline Drive in Conway. The meeting will be from 11 a.m. until 2 p.m. Lunch will not be provided; however, attendees can show up early to order and pay for their meals before the meeting.
The Arkansas Angus Association is strictly an Arkansas producer group; although, anyone is welcome to attend the meeting to hear Bullard’s presentation. RSVP to Maybelle at (501) 593-1295 or casterfarm@gmail.com.

Ranchers Cattlemen Action Legal Fund United Stockgrowers of America (R-CALF USA) is the largest producer-only cattle trade association in the United States. It is a national, nonprofit organization dedicated to ensuring the continued profitability and viability of the U.S. cattle and sheep industries.
